import type { GesturePhase, GestureSource, HandSample, RepCompletedInfo, TrackingQuality } from './types'
export interface ClassifierOutput {
phase: GesturePhase
trackingQuality: TrackingQuality
openness: number
compression: number
holdProgress: number
source: GestureSource
rep?: RepCompletedInfo
}
/**
* 开合状态机(握力环校准版)
* 计数:OPEN → CLOSING → CLOSED(保持) → REOPENING → 相对张开,才 +1
* 松开不必完全张开:相对握紧谷底抬升即可计次,避免做到后期张不开导致卡在 29
*/
export function createOpenCloseClassifier(options?: {
openEnter?: number
openExit?: number
closeEnter?: number
closeExit?: number
minHoldMs?: number
lostMs?: number
emaAlpha?: number
/** 相对松开:相对握紧谷底至少抬升这么多才计 1 次 */
reopenRise?: number
}) {
const openEnter = options?.openEnter ?? 0.48
const openExit = options?.openExit ?? 0.4
const closeEnter = options?.closeEnter ?? 0.38
const closeExit = options?.closeExit ?? 0.44
const minHoldMs = options?.minHoldMs ?? 140
const lostMs = options?.lostMs ?? 1200
const emaAlpha = options?.emaAlpha ?? 0.4
const reopenRise = options?.reopenRise ?? 0.1
let phase: GesturePhase = 'UNTRACKED'
let openness = 0.5
let holdStartedAt = 0
let holdProgress = 0
let lastSeenAt = 0
let opennessPeak = 0
let closedTrough = 1
let source: GestureSource = 'none'
let lastRepTs = 0
let reopenRiseActive = reopenRise
function resetPartial() {
holdStartedAt = 0
holdProgress = 0
opennessPeak = 0
closedTrough = 1
}
/** 接近目标次数时进一步放宽松开判定 */
function setNearGoal(enabled: boolean) {
reopenRiseActive = enabled ? 0.045 : reopenRise
}
function canCountRep(now: number) {
// 防连发:两次有效计次至少间隔 280ms
return now - lastRepTs >= 280
}
function update(sample: HandSample | null, now = Date.now()): ClassifierOutput {
let rep: RepCompletedInfo | undefined
if (!sample || sample.score <= 0.05) {
if (lastSeenAt && now - lastSeenAt > lostMs) {
phase = 'UNTRACKED'
resetPartial()
}
const withinGrace = lastSeenAt > 0 && now - lastSeenAt <= 600
return {
phase,
trackingQuality: phase === 'UNTRACKED' ? 'lost' : withinGrace ? 'good' : 'weak',
openness,
compression: 1 - openness,
holdProgress,
source,
rep,
}
}
lastSeenAt = now
source = sample.source
openness = openness * (1 - emaAlpha) + sample.openness * emaAlpha
const quality: TrackingQuality = sample.score >= 0.22 ? 'good' : 'weak'
switch (phase) {
case 'UNTRACKED':
if (openness >= openEnter) {
phase = 'OPEN_READY'
opennessPeak = openness
resetPartial()
}
break
case 'OPEN_READY':
opennessPeak = Math.max(opennessPeak, openness)
if (openness <= closeEnter) {
phase = 'CLOSING'
closedTrough = openness
}
break
case 'CLOSING':
closedTrough = Math.min(closedTrough, openness)
if (openness <= closeEnter) {
phase = 'CLOSED_CONFIRMED'
holdStartedAt = now
holdProgress = 0
closedTrough = openness
} else if (openness >= openEnter) {
phase = 'OPEN_READY'
}
break
case 'CLOSED_CONFIRMED': {
closedTrough = Math.min(closedTrough, openness)
const held = now - holdStartedAt
holdProgress = Math.min(1, held / minHoldMs)
if (held >= minHoldMs && openness >= closeExit) {
phase = 'REOPENING'
} else if (openness >= openEnter && held < minHoldMs) {
// 保持不足就完全张开:作废本轮
phase = 'OPEN_READY'
resetPartial()
}
break
}
case 'REOPENING': {
closedTrough = Math.min(closedTrough, openness)
const rise = openness - closedTrough
// 绝对张开,或相对握紧谷底抬升足够 → 计 1 次
const reopened = openness >= openEnter || (rise >= reopenRiseActive && openness >= closeExit)
if (reopened && canCountRep(now)) {
lastRepTs = now
rep = {
ts: now,
holdMs: holdStartedAt ? now - holdStartedAt : 0,
opennessPeak,
source,
}
phase = 'OPEN_READY'
resetPartial()
opennessPeak = openness
} else if (openness <= closeEnter) {
// 松开中又握回去:回到保持,不直接作废
phase = 'CLOSED_CONFIRMED'
holdStartedAt = now
holdProgress = 0
}
break
}
}
return {
phase,
trackingQuality: quality,
openness,
compression: 1 - openness,
holdProgress,
source,
rep,
}
}
function reset() {
phase = 'UNTRACKED'
openness = 0.5
source = 'none'
lastSeenAt = 0
lastRepTs = 0
reopenRiseActive = reopenRise
resetPartial()
}
function getPhase() {
return phase
}
return { update, reset, getPhase, setNearGoal }
}
export type OpenCloseClassifier = ReturnType<typeof createOpenCloseClassifier>
